William "Doc" McClelland

William “Doc” McClelland was a giant in the football world at the turn of the last century. He played 75 games for Melbourne, was on a back flank in Melbourne’s 1900 premiership side and captained the team for the next four years.

He would become president of the Melbourne Cricket Club and from 1926 until 1955 President of the Victorian Football League.  In 1996 this mighty player and administrator was posthumously inducted into the Australian Football Hall of Fame.
